cms-patatrack / pixeltrack-standalone

Standalone Patatrack pixel tracking
Apache License 2.0
17 stars 35 forks source link

Update the SYCL builds #397

Closed fwyzard closed 1 year ago

fwyzard commented 1 year ago

Update sycl and sycltest to SYCL 2020/oneAPI 2023.1.0. Update hwloc to 2.9.2 and use the prebuilt package. Add experimental support for renaming the target binaries and directories. Update the SYCL compilation flags. Apply code formatting to the sycl backend.

fwyzard commented 1 year ago

@AuroraPerego can you double check the SYCL changes to the Makefile ?

fwyzard commented 1 year ago

@makortel I'm ready to merge this before looking into further changes to the sycl and alpaka backends